  2. Finally got it working. Going back to 22.3.16 To sum it up. Install the missing ip command we see in the log. start Xeoma and "quickly" click the icon and select $_ console run the commands apt update apt install iproute2 stop the Xeoma docker container Download Linux 64bit version from https://felenasoft.com/xeoma/en/changes/ (scroll down a bit) Put it in your config folder, for me it is /mnt/user/appdata/Xeoma Rename the file to xeoma_22.3.16.tgz Put it in /mnt/user/appdata/Xeoma/downloads/ I also unpacked it via a shell by going to the downloads folder and running the command tar zxvf xeoma_22.3.16.tgz then I went back to /mnt/user/appdata/Xeoma changed the config file as below # The password for clients to use to connect. Avoid backslashes and apostrophes. PASSWORD='xxxxxxxxx' # The version to use. Valid values are a string like '17.5.5', 'latest', 'latest_beta', or a URL. VERSION='22.3.16' Started Xeoma in the Unraid docker tab. I'm back up and running. With the missing ip command, it may work with the latest but right now, I just want to be up and running again.

  4. I know this is an old thread. However, thought it would be usefull for for others coming across this. When you have working with multiple networks on a server (any computer), you have to think about routing. There is no guarantee that the return traffic is going back on the same interface as the request arrives on. Traffic may arrive on nic1 but return traffic may go back via nic2. On linux, you can control this in detail by createing unique routing tables per nic etc. You will however get a very complicated network setup.... if you have multiple networks, you can use specific routing where network a, b, and c are using nic1 (with routing entries in unraid) and network d, e, and f are using nic2 (with rouging for that in unraid). However, I would strongly suggest, using LACP and bond your network cards to that (must be same speed). (sure, you may have to buy a managed switch for a couple o hundred dollars, but worth every penny) If need to, configure QOS on your switch. Sending data to Unraid, while streaming, should not be a problem as you are looking at dataflows in two different directions. Make sure you have a cache drive that is minimum twise the speed of your network, and configure yours shares to use the cache drive to write new content. (I.e. you stream from your hdd, write new content to cache) Rule nr 1. Keep it simple! Rule nr 2. Simplify, i possible. Rule nr 3. Go to 1. /Martin

  6. If you need more SATA ports, I recommend you go for a SAS card and break out cables (sas -> 4 SATA connectors). Ideally two SAS ports giving you up to 8 SATA devices. However, this allows you in the future to use the card for SAS back planes. There are plenty of Dell (LSI) cards out there for not much money. I picked up mine on EBay for about $40 with 2 break out cables. I use to have PCIe SATA card (4 ports) but occationally, they generated CRC errors with fast disks (SSD). My $0.02... Martin
  7. I'm using (recently built it) the X470D4U with a Ryzen 5 3600 (gen 3) and 16GB ECC Ram. You don't need a keyboard and mouse for the Mobo. You can use the IPMI to manage the server from another computer. I.e. IPMI allow you to manage the server such as power off/on, patch firmware, remote console etc. Apart from the two USB3 in the back, there is one socket for another two USB3 ports. I installed a two port USB3 adapter directly on the mobo so my USB Unraid device id "directly" on the mobo. Apart from the IPMI port, there are two more ethernet ports that I have in active/active mode to improve the network throughput. Yet to play with the different options for optimum performance. Connected to a Unifi switch so it can in theory do all the different modes. The M.2 seem a bit sad. Was looking at using them for NVMe cache. But I can not find any NVMe SSD to match the "specs".   21. Hi I'm new to unraid but have used linux for a long time. There is a tool called fdupes in linux. Not sure how hard it would be to add to unraid standard cmd commands. But for now, you could nfs mount a share to a unix/linux computer and run fdupes agains the nfs share. When / if fdupes can be included in unraid, you could run it agains /mnt/user/sharename and find duplicated per share or across all shares fdupes /mnt/user My $0.02 /Martin
